Eu quero falar sobre APRO de uma maneira que pareça natural e clara, porque quando olho de perto, o coração do APRO não é complicado, embora o sistema em si seja profundo, e tudo começa a partir de uma verdade básica, que é que as blockchains vivem em seu próprio espaço fechado, onde podem ver regras de saldos e transações, mas não podem ver o mundo exterior, a menos que algo traga essa informação, e é exatamente aqui que o APRO entra, porque existe para conectar dados do mundo real com contratos inteligentes de uma maneira que pareça segura, estável e confiável, e se essa conexão for fraca, então cada aplicação construída sobre isso se torna frágil, então o APRO é projetado com a ideia de que a verdade deve ser protegida antes de tocar no código da cadeia.
Eu vejo a APRO como uma ponte entre dois ambientes muito diferentes, onde um lado está cheio de informações barulhentas e em rápida mudança, como preços, eventos, relatórios e resultados, e o outro lado é um mundo automatizado rigoroso, onde o código é executado sem emoção ou hesitação. Se dados errados cruzam essa ponte, então o dano acontece instantaneamente e sem misericórdia, então a APRO usa uma abordagem híbrida, onde os dados são coletados e processados fora da cadeia para permanecer rápidos e flexíveis e depois verificados e entregues na cadeia para permanecer transparentes e baseados em regras. Esse equilíbrio é importante porque velocidade sem confiança é perigosa e confiança sem velocidade é inútil, então o design tenta respeitar ambas as realidades ao mesmo tempo.
Eles estão usando duas maneiras principais de entregar dados, que são Data Push e Data Pull, e essa é uma das partes mais importantes do sistema, porque diferentes aplicações vivem em diferentes velocidades e têm necessidades de custo diferentes. Data Push significa que o oráculo envia atualizações automaticamente à medida que os dados mudam, o que é útil para sistemas que devem sempre saber o último estado, como mercados de empréstimos e motores de risco, enquanto Data Pull significa que a aplicação pede dados apenas quando precisa, o que é perfeito para contratos que querem controle sobre tempo e custo. Eu gosto dessa flexibilidade, porque significa que os construtores não são forçados a um modelo que pode não se encaixar em sua lógica ou orçamento.
Quando penso em Data Push, imagino um fluxo constante de atualizações que mantém um sistema ciente do que está acontecendo em tempo real. Isso pode proteger sistemas que dependem de monitoramento constante, mas também cria responsabilidade, porque uma atualização enviada deve ser precisa e bem verificada. Portanto, a APRO trata esse modelo com cuidado, focando na validação e coordenação em toda a rede, porque o perigo não é apenas a inatividade, mas também uma atualização errada que chega no pior momento possível, e um oráculo forte deve ser entediante no sentido de que se comporta da mesma forma sob estresse como faz durante períodos calmos.
Data Pull parece diferente porque devolve o controle à aplicação. Nesse modelo, o contrato decide quando precisa de verdade e faz um pedido, e o oráculo responde com uma resposta nova. Isso pode economizar custos e reduzir ruído, mas também significa que o oráculo deve estar pronto a todo momento para responder rapidamente, então latência e confiabilidade ainda são profundamente importantes. A APRO projeta esse modelo de forma que até mesmo pedidos sob demanda possam ser respondidos rapidamente sem sacrificar a precisão, porque uma resposta atrasada pode bloquear a execução e prejudicar a experiência do usuário tanto quanto dados ruins podem.
Uma das ideias mais profundas dentro da APRO é o design de rede em duas camadas, e eu vejo isso como uma maneira de manter a ordem à medida que o sistema cresce, porque um oráculo não está realizando um trabalho simples, mas muitos trabalhos ao mesmo tempo, como coletar dados, limpá-los, comparar fontes, verificar anomalias, concordar com um valor final e entregá-lo a muitas cadeias. Se tudo isso acontece em uma estrutura plana, torna-se frágil. Portanto, separar responsabilidades em camadas permite que o sistema escale enquanto mantém cada parte focada em seu papel, e se uma parte tiver problemas, a outra ainda pode impor regras, o que melhora a resiliência.
A descentralização desempenha um papel muito real aqui, porque em um contexto de oráculo, reduz diretamente o risco de manipulação e falha. Eles estão contando com múltiplos operadores independentes para que nenhum único ator possa decidir a verdade sozinho, porque se um operador mente ou sai do ar, o sistema ainda deve funcionar. A agregação entre muitos operadores torna os ataques mais difíceis e caros, especialmente durante momentos voláteis, quando os incentivos para manipular dados são mais altos, então a APRO visa tornar o comportamento honesto o caminho mais fácil, alinhando recompensas com desempenho correto.
Incentivos são críticos porque a entrega de dados não é gratuita e a confiabilidade requer esforço, então a rede precisa de um modelo econômico sustentável, onde os operadores são recompensados por permanecer online e precisos e os usuários pagam de forma justa pelo serviço que consomem. Se esse equilíbrio estiver errado, então a qualidade cai ou os custos explodem, então a APRO inclui uma camada de incentivo projetada para apoiar operações de longo prazo, em vez de hype de curto prazo, porque um oráculo é infraestrutura e a infraestrutura deve sobreviver a dias entediantes, assim como caóticos.
Eles também estão trazendo verificação impulsionada por IA para o sistema e acho que a maneira certa de entender isso é como um assistente, em vez de um juiz, porque a IA pode ajudar a analisar grandes volumes de informações, detectar padrões estranhos, comparar fontes e processar dados não estruturados, como texto e relatórios. Mas a verdade final ainda precisa de regras claras e acordo descentralizado, e quando a IA trabalha ao lado da verificação tradicional, pode expandir que tipos de dados o oráculo pode lidar com segurança, o que é importante se a rede quiser suportar mais do que apenas feeds de preços numéricos limpos.
A aleatoriedade verificável é outra parte importante da APRO, porque muitas aplicações precisam de resultados que não podem ser previstos ou influenciados, especialmente jogos e sistemas de seleção. A aleatoriedade fraca destrói a confiança rapidamente, então fornecer aleatoriedade que pode ser verificada dá aos construtores a confiança de que os resultados são justos. Isso se encaixa naturalmente com o objetivo da APRO de ser um oráculo de propósito geral que suporta muitos tipos de aplicações, em vez de um serviço de uso único restrito.
Eu também percebo que a APRO é projetada com suporte a múltiplas cadeias em mente, e esse não é um pequeno desafio, porque cada blockchain se comporta de maneira diferente e tem custos, tempos e padrões diferentes. Portanto, apoiar muitas cadeias significa que o oráculo deve se adaptar sem perder consistência, e quando você adiciona suporte para muitos tipos de ativos, como ativos digitais, ativos do mundo real, eventos e dados de jogos, a complexidade cresce ainda mais. Mas a recompensa é que os desenvolvedores podem confiar em uma única estrutura de oráculo em vez de costurar juntas muitas soluções frágeis, o que pode reduzir o risco em todo o ecossistema.
Do ponto de vista de um construtor, a integração é tão importante quanto as funcionalidades, porque mesmo o oráculo mais forte falha se for difícil de usar. Portanto, a APRO enfatiza interfaces claras, comportamento previsível e opções de entrega flexíveis. Se eu me imagino construindo uma aplicação séria, quero saber não apenas como ler um feed, mas também o que acontece durante casos extremos, como atrasos, picos ou interrupções temporárias, porque a confiança é construída nesses momentos, não em condições perfeitas.
Se eu dar um passo atrás e olhar o quadro geral, então a APRO está tentando resolver um dos problemas mais difíceis em sistemas descentralizados, que é como trazer a verdade do mundo real para um ambiente automatizado sem comprometer a segurança. Eles estão fazendo isso ao combinar Data Push e Data Pull para flexibilidade, arquitetura em camadas para escalabilidade, descentralização para segurança, verificação assistida por IA para manuseio de dados mais ricos e aleatoriedade verificável para justiça. Se todas essas partes funcionarem juntas, então o oráculo se torna algo que apóia discretamente aplicações sem chamar atenção para si mesmo, que é exatamente o que uma boa infraestrutura deve fazer, porque quando um oráculo funciona bem, ninguém fala sobre isso e quando falha, todos sentem isso instantaneamente.
